One of the stranger Twin Cities holiday traditions gets underway this weekend. It's the arrival of the British Television Advertising Awards Show at the Walker Art Center in Minneapolis. There are drumming gorillas, hapless surfers and animated talking dogs looking for a good home.
Peter Bigg is Chief Executive of the British Television Awards and he'll introduce Friday's screenings. He told Minnesota Public Radio's Euan Kerr that the awards contain some things people might not think of as TV ads, at least not at first.
Peter Bigg will introduce the British Television Advertisng Award at the Walker tomorrow night. The Walker has 66 screenings scheduled and has already sold almost 9,500 tickets for the event.
